SPS Announces 2016 Class of Distinguished Lecturers
The IEEE Signal Processing Society (SPS) announced the 2016 Class of Distinguished Lecturers. Six colleagues were honored and they are: Jan Allebach (Purdue University); Yoram Bresler (University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ign); Peyman Milanfar (Google Inc.); Hermann Ney (RWTH Aachen University); Paris Smaragdis (University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ign); and Josiane Zerubia (INRIA).
